Add 63/35 and 28/60

1st number: 1 28/35, 2nd number: 28/60

63/35 + 28/60 is 34/15.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 35 and 60 is 420

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 420
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 35 × 12 = 420,
    63/35 = 63 × 12/35 × 12 = 756/420
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 60 × 7 = 420,
    28/60 = 28 × 7/60 × 7 = 196/420
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    756/420 + 196/420 = 756 + 196/420 = 952/420
  5. 952/420 simplified gives 34/15
  6. So, 63/35 + 28/60 = 34/15
